Default Tuna Trip - Mudhole, NJ

Skipped work today to take advantage of the nice weather and get out to the area of some good reports of bluefin and yellowfin tuna lately. Also the first offshore trip on the SC.

Apparently the area has been hush hush recently, but that ended today when we arrived to a fleet jigging, chunking, and trolling.

The bite was hot and cold and unfortunately we did not get into any of the bluefin or yellowfin (although apparently the bite heated up on our way home, go figure).

Did manage a few skippies on the jig, albies on the troll, and a nice mahi on a sardine.

Just a beautiful day on the water.
